Transcribed Image Text:A pedometer treats walking 2,000 steps as walking 1 mile. Write a steps ToMiles() method that takes the number of steps as an integer
parameter and returns the miles walked as a double. The steps ToMiles() method throws an Exception object with the message "Exception:
Negative step count entered." when the number of steps is negative. Complete the main() method that reads the number of steps from a
user, calls the steps ToMiles () method, and outputs the returned value from the steps ToMiles () method. Use a try-catch block to catch any
Exception object thrown by the steps ToMiles() method and output the exception message.
Output each floating-point value with two digits after the decimal point, which can be achieved as follows:
yourValue);
System.out.printf("%.2f",
Ex: If the input of the program is:
5345
the output of the program is:
2.67
Ex: If the input of the program is:
-3850
the output of the program is:
Exception: Negative step count entered.
